The station has a robust ticketing facility, complete with a ticket office that operates from 06:20 to 22:04 on weekdays and Saturdays, and 09:10 to 16:45 on Sundays. Swift travel arrangements are facilitated thanks to accessible ticket machines and the ability to conveniently collect tickets purchased online.
For those needing assistance, help points and staff are available during ticket office hours. Although the station lacks certain amenities like luggage storage, toilets, and baby changing facilities, it compensates with other essential features. Cambuslang station is equipped with departure screens and announcements for travel updates, ensuring that your experience is as seamless as possible.
Accessibility is a key consideration, although some areas might be challenging for travellers with limited mobility. The station features step-free access, ramps to lower ground platforms, and induction loops for hearing assistance. Despite this, the station lacks dedicated accessible parking and wheelchairs. For assistance with boarding, simply request a ramp from the trained staff.

The station facilities at Haltwhistle are modest yet functional, ensuring a stress-free transit despite the absence of a ticket office. Tickets can be collected from accessible machines on-site, and the presence of an induction loop makes purchasing tickets inclusive for those with hearing impairments. While the station lacks staff support and specific facilities like waiting rooms and lounges, essential information is made available through screens and announcements. The station, although not entirely step-free, does provide ramped access, ensuring those with mobility challenges can still navigate the station with ease. Parking is ample, with 22 spaces available free of charge all week long.
Once you arrive at Haltwhistle, you won't be left stranded. The station provides robust transport connections through various modes including taxis and local bus services, ensuring you make onward journeys without fuss. For those relying on a rail replacement service, provisions are in place to pick up and drop off at the station entrance, ensuring continuity in travel. If pedaling around appeals to you, the station houses cycle racks, though bicycle hire isn’t available on-site.
